Transaction 14e109e78f1363002b62f1cfa14eeefd9e8418405d2ccd682a76be1e7d5e7842
1 Input
1 Output
-
14e109e78f1363002b62f1cfa14eeefd9e8418405d2ccd682a76be1e7d5e7842: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0e68dfd76570698929a321b61b8bfba65fa1101daa5879a67bfbf0ace662673f
- address
- bc1ppe5dl4m9wp5cj2dryxmphzlm5e06zyqa4fv8nfnml0c2eenzvulstduegk